New England's Acknowledged 'Gorilla' - EMC, Inc. - Heads Roster of Presenting Companies at Tech Stocks Forum Sept. 12 in Boston

BOSTON, Sep 7, 2000 /PRNewswire via COMTEX/ -- A "gorilla" in business parlance is the unquestioned leader in a specific industry or sector. And by everyone's definition, EMC, Inc. (NYSE: EMC chart, msgs) of Hopkinton, MA, fits the bill.

EMC leads a cast of seven public companies that will have executives presenting to individual investors at the InformedInvestors.com Communications and Technology Stocks Forum on Tuesday, Sept. 12 at the Sheraton Boston Hotel. Attendance is $25 prepaid, $40 at the door. The conference runs from 8:30 a.m.-3 p.m. (EDT). Get details at www.InformedInvestors.com or call 800-992-4683.

This Forum allows individual investors to don their analyst's hat, hear executive-level presentations and ask questions. Other companies scheduled to present include: HotJobs.com, BEA Systems, Innodata, Network Commerce, Prime Response and Verida Internet Corp.

EMC has made incredible progress in the past several years as it benefits from the enormous demand for storage systems, software, networks and services that provide 24/7 access to all of the information businesses and individuals need to prosper in the Information Economy. Consider these "factoids" found on EMC's home page.

In 1999, 80 percent of EMC's sales came from products the company introduced that same year; EMC's stock has split six times since 1992; during the 1990s, EMC achieved the highest single-decade performance of any listed stock in New York Stock Exchange history ... from January 1, 1990, to December 31, 1999, EMC's stock rose 80,575%; Over the past decade EMC's average annual return has been 95%; it averaged 130% over the past three years; and two-thirds of the world's electronic information lives on EMC.
